Dear faculty and staff,

Beginning Tuesday, July 19 and continuing until Tuesday, July 26, your Windows-based computer will be migrated to the central UConn Active Directory (AD).

Your migration will occur one evening during this one week window. Please check the workstation schedule to find out your date. The evening before your workstation is scheduled to be migrated:
• Save all work and close all programs.
• Re-start your computer. (The success rate is much higher for machines that have been restarted.)

Laptops will need to be reconfigured to work with the UConn AD. Please follow the same steps above for your SoE Windows-based laptop. If your laptop is not configured on the scheduled day, bring your laptop to the ETS Help Desk to have it configured by a UITS or SoE technician.

Once your migration is complete, your login will change. You will login with your UConn NetID and NetID password on the UConn domain. For more information about the changes and support options, visit http://soe-migration.uconn.edu.
